Overview of Myelodysplastic Syndrome (MDS)
Myelodysplastic Syndrome (MDS) is a group of disorders characterized by dysfunctional blood cell production in the bone marrow. This condition predominantly affects elderly individuals and is associated with an increased risk of developing acute myeloid leukemia (AML). The primary features include ineffective hematopoiesis, leading to insufficient production of normal blood cells (red cells, white cells, and platelets). MDS is classified based on the types and severity of blood cell abnormalities, which guide treatment strategies.
Treatment Approaches for MDS
The treatment landscape for MDS aims to alleviate symptoms, improve quality of life, and potentially delay progression to acute leukemia. Common treatment modalities include supportive care with blood transfusions and growth factors, disease-modifying therapies such as hypomethylating agents (azacitidine and decitabine), and immunosuppressive therapies for specific subsets of patients. Stem cell transplantation offers a curative option for eligible individuals, although it is associated with significant risks and complications.
Types of Myelodysplastic Syndrome
MDS is classified into several types based on the World Health Organization (WHO) classification system, which considers the percentage of blasts in the bone marrow and the cytogenetic abnormalities present. The main subtypes include refractory cytopenia with unilineage dysplasia (RCUD), refractory cytopenia with multilineage dysplasia (RCMD), refractory anemia with excess blasts (RAEB), and MDS with isolated del(5q) abnormality. Each subtype varies in terms of prognosis and response to treatment.
